Overview of Broiler and Layer Breeds
When it comes to raising chickens for eggs, understanding the difference between broiler and layer breeds is crucial. Broilers are bred specifically for their meat production, while layers are raised for egg-laying purposes. This distinction affects their reproductive maturity, as layer breeds are designed to start laying eggs at a younger age.
Typically, layer breeds begin producing eggs around 18-24 weeks of age, depending on factors such as breed, nutrition, and overall health. In contrast, broiler breeds may not reach full egg-laying capacity until they’re significantly older, often beyond their meat harvest age. It’s essential to choose the right breed for your needs, whether you’re aiming for a high egg output or want to raise chickens for meat.
For example, Leghorn and Rhode Island Red are popular layer breeds known for their high egg production. These birds typically start laying eggs at around 20-22 weeks of age and can produce up to 300 eggs per year. On the other hand, broiler breeds like Cornish Cross are bred for their fast growth rate and may not reach reproductive maturity until they’re much older.
When selecting a breed, consider your goals and choose one that aligns with them. If you want high egg production, opt for a layer breed specifically designed for this purpose. If you’re raising chickens for meat, broiler breeds are often the better choice.

What is the Average Age for Chickens to Start Laying?
As a backyard farmer, understanding when your chickens will start laying eggs is crucial for planning and managing your flock. The age at which chickens begin laying eggs is influenced by various factors, including breed, nutrition, and health. Generally, most chicken breeds start laying eggs between 18 to 24 weeks of age. However, some heritage breeds may take up to 28 weeks or more to reach maturity.
For example, Leghorns are known for their rapid egg production and typically begin laying at around 20-22 weeks old. On the other hand, Orpingtons can take a bit longer, often starting to lay between 24-26 weeks of age. When selecting breeds for your backyard flock, consider factors such as climate, available space, and feeding schedule.
It’s also essential to note that proper nutrition plays a significant role in egg production. Ensure your chickens have access to high-quality feed and clean water at all times. By providing optimal conditions, you can support your flock’s development and encourage healthy egg-laying habits.

Nutritional Requirements for Optimal Egg Production
To support optimal egg production and health in laying hens, it’s essential to provide them with a well-balanced diet rich in essential nutrients. A layer’s diet should consist of around 16-18% protein, which can be achieved through a combination of high-quality grains like oats, barley, and wheat, as well as legumes such as soybeans and peas.
Laying hens also require a significant amount of calcium to support strong bone development and eggshell production. A minimum of 3.5% calcium in their diet is recommended, which can be achieved through the inclusion of calcium-rich ingredients like crushed oyster shells or dark leafy greens.
In addition to these macronutrients, laying hens also require a range of micronutrients including vitamins A, D, E, and K, as well as minerals like phosphorus, potassium, and zinc. To ensure your flock is getting all the necessary nutrients, consider consulting with a poultry nutritionist or using a high-quality commercial layer feed.
It’s worth noting that the nutritional requirements for laying hens can vary depending on factors such as age, breed, and production level. Be sure to adjust their diet accordingly to support optimal egg production and health.

Creating a Suitable Environment for Laying Chickens
To support healthy egg-laying hens, it’s essential to create a suitable environment for them. This begins with providing adequate housing that meets their specific needs. When it comes to space, chickens require about 2-4 square feet per bird inside the coop, and at least 8-10 square feet of outdoor run space per chicken.
Ventilation is another critical aspect of egg-laying hen health. A well-ventilated coop will help prevent respiratory issues caused by ammonia buildup from droppings. Aim for a minimum of one window or ventilation opening for every 10-15 square feet of coop space. Consider installing a roof vent to ensure proper airflow.
Shelter is also vital, particularly in areas with harsh weather conditions. Chickens need protection from rain, wind, and sun exposure. Make sure the coop has a waterproof roof, walls, and floor. Add some insulation, such as straw or wood shavings, to keep it cozy during colder months.

Sample Diets for Different Stages of Reproductive Development
Providing the right diet for your laying hens is crucial at every stage of their development. A well-planned feeding program ensures optimal reproductive performance and egg production. Here’s a breakdown of sample diets tailored to support different stages of reproductive development.
For young pullets, it’s essential to provide a starter feed that promotes healthy growth and development. Look for a starter feed containing 16-18% protein and 1.2-1.4% calcium. For example, consider feeding your pullets a starter feed specifically formulated for broiler-type chickens. This type of feed will support their rapid growth rate.
As your pullets transition into the grower stage, typically around 18-20 weeks old, switch to a grower feed containing 16-17% protein and 1.2-1.3% calcium. This feed will continue to promote healthy growth while preparing them for egg production.
When your hens reach full maturity at around 24-26 weeks of age, shift to a layer feed specifically formulated to support reproductive development and high egg production. A good layer feed should contain 16-18% protein and 3.5-4% calcium.
In addition to these dietary recommendations, consider supplementing with oyster shells or crushed eggshells to provide extra calcium for strong eggshell formation.
